This meeting of the Highland Lakes Chapter of the Native Plant Society of Texas is FREE and open to the public. Featured speaker Jess Divin, an ISA Master Arborist, will be joined by certified arborists Talia Freeman, Kyle White, and William Johnston to present "Improving the Cultural Practices of Tree Care."
Jess will address some of the questions and qualms of the common tree admirer, such as:
- Improving conditions in our harsh climate
- Common tree care faux pas
- Common pests of Central Texas
- How to mitigate tree stressors
Jess is an International Society of Arboriculture Board Certified Master Arborist, Texas ISA Oak Wilt Qualified, and Tree Risk Assessor Qualified. He is currently a District Manager at the East San Antonio Davey Tree, which spans from Rockport to Blanco. Throughout the years, Jess has arboricultural experience from entry level technician to District Manager at Davey Tree. He was also a wildland firefighter in Colorado, the Park Ranger Superintendent and Urban Forester for the city of New Braunfels, TX.
